Abstract
La presente invención se refiere a métodos para el diagnóstico de trastornos relacionados con el embarazo, la determinación de relaciones alélicas, determinación de las contribuciones maternas o fetales con respecto a las transcripciones que circulan y/o la identificación de marcadores maternos o fetales utilizando una muestra de un sujeto femenino embarazado. También se proporciona el uso de un gen para el diagnóstico de un trastorno relacionado con el embarazo en un sujeto femenino embarazado.
